Unboxing The $10 Million Dollar Invite-Only Credit Card: The JP Morgan Reserve - Summary

Summary

A YouTube creator has obtained a highly exclusive JP Morgan Reserve credit card, typically reserved for clients with over $10 million in investable assets. The card offers benefits similar to the Chase Sapphire Reserve, including a $300 annual travel credit, 3x points on travel and dining, and airport lounge access. The creator was able to obtain the card through a private banking relationship, despite not meeting the typical wealth requirement. The card is made of metal, possibly with palladium, and is significantly heavier than other metal credit cards. Facts

1. The JP Morgan Reserve card is a highly exclusive credit card that is typically only available to JP Morgan private banking customers with over $10 million in investable assets.
2. The card has a $450 annual fee and offers benefits such as a $300 travel credit, three times points on travel and dining, and airport lounge access.
3. The card is made of metal and has a significant weight to it.
4. The card was previously known as the JPMorgan Palladium card, which was made of palladium and was estimated to be worth $800 to $1,000.
5. In 2017, JP Morgan discontinued the Palladium card and rebranded it as the JP Morgan Reserve card, lowering the annual fee to $450.
6. The card has a sign-up bonus of 60,000 points when you spend $4,000 in the first three months.
7. The card has a $300 travel credit that can be used twice, once in the current year and again on January 1st of the next year.
8. The card is significantly heavier than the American Express Platinum card.
9. The card has a unique design and comes in a box that feels like leather.
10. The card can set off metal detectors due to its metal composition.
